Heavy snow storms heavy killed at least 32 people in Northern China (most of the deaths happened from car accidents). More than 15,000 buildings have collapsed, and more than 300,000 hectares of winter crops were destroyed. Also, more than 166,000 people had to evacuate there homes. The heavy snowfalls started on Monday in central and northern parts of China. The capital of Beijing was struck by three successive snowfalls. Beijing and the area around it is not very equipped with de-icing supplies and snow plows. These have been China's heaviest snowfalls according to records that have been keep since 1949
